SDI ONLINE WRECK DIVER COURSE: Wreck diving can be one of the most exciting aspects of sport diving and can uncover pieces of history seen by few others, however every effort must be made to maximize safe diving techniques. The SDI Online Wreck Diver course will discuss and use equipment and techniques commonly employed while wreck diving. This course may be taught as a 1) non-penetration (2 total dives) or 2) limited-penetration (3 total dives) course. In the event of Limited Penetration Training, limited penetration is defined as swim through or within the ambient light of entry point,. On-line Open Water Program
1. Complete your on-line training then call us at 256-326-9053 to arrange your Review Session and Pool Training.
2. Come in for your three-hour review session. During this session you will complete some paperwork, review your online quizzes with your instructor and be introduced to and learn how to assemble and disassemble your scuba equipment. You will also pay the remainder of your course fee to Better Diver if the online course was purchased via the website when you enrolled. The course fee covers the Review, Confined, and Open Water training sessions.
3. The final phase of your SCUBA education is in-water skills training. This training is done in a confined water setting, most often in the swimming pool but occasionally at a local quarry. This phase may take anywhere from 3 to 9 hours depending upon how you progress in your skills. Both the review and the confined water phases of training can often be completed in one weekend. Contact us for more information or with any questions at 256-326-9053.
4. Before you can receive your SCUBA certification card, you must complete four Open Water check-out (or certification) dives. These can be completed with us or we can give you a Universal Referral Form so you can complete your check-out dives on your next vacation. The Universal Referral Form allows you to choose an Instructor from any Internationally recognized training agency to complete your dives with you.

Checkout Dive Information
Upon completion of any academic course and associated pool work, students must complete four open water checkout dives with a qualified Instructor. You may do your checkouts with us or we will give you a universal referral form that allows you to complete your checkouts with any qualified Instructor worldwide. When using the Universal Referral Form, you will negotiate the checkout price with the Instructor/Facility of your choosing.
We do not charge you for referral checkouts, however there is a $20 processing fee for your C-card upon your return. Please ask your Instructor for complete details. The card processing fee is waived when checkouts are completed with us.
